Home
last modified time | relevance | path

Searched refs:VirtualKeyMap (Results 1 – 6 of 6) sorted by relevance

/frameworks/native/libs/input/
DVirtualKeyMap.cpp39 VirtualKeyMap::VirtualKeyMap() { in VirtualKeyMap() function in android::VirtualKeyMap
42 VirtualKeyMap::~VirtualKeyMap() { in ~VirtualKeyMap()
45 std::unique_ptr<VirtualKeyMap> VirtualKeyMap::load(const std::string& filename) { in load()
54 std::unique_ptr<VirtualKeyMap> map(new VirtualKeyMap()); in load()
72 VirtualKeyMap::Parser::Parser(VirtualKeyMap* map, Tokenizer* tokenizer) : in Parser()
76 VirtualKeyMap::Parser::~Parser() { in ~Parser()
79 status_t VirtualKeyMap::Parser::parse() { in parse()
132 bool VirtualKeyMap::Parser::consumeFieldDelimiterAndSkipWhitespace() { in consumeFieldDelimiterAndSkipWhitespace()
142 bool VirtualKeyMap::Parser::parseNextIntField(int32_t* outValue) { in parseNextIntField()
DAndroid.bp32 "VirtualKeyMap.cpp",
/frameworks/native/include/input/
DVirtualKeyMap.h49 class VirtualKeyMap {
51 ~VirtualKeyMap();
53 static std::unique_ptr<VirtualKeyMap> load(const std::string& filename);
61 VirtualKeyMap* mMap;
65 Parser(VirtualKeyMap* map, Tokenizer* tokenizer);
76 VirtualKeyMap();
/frameworks/base/tools/validatekeymaps/
DMain.cpp131 std::unique_ptr<VirtualKeyMap> map = VirtualKeyMap::load(filename); in validateFile()
/frameworks/native/services/inputflinger/
DEventHub.h348 std::unique_ptr<VirtualKeyMap> virtualKeyMap;
DEventHub.cpp1633 device->virtualKeyMap = VirtualKeyMap::load(path); in loadVirtualKeyMapLocked()